#757f61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#757f61 is composed of 45.9% red, 49.8%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 80 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 43.9%. #757f61 color hex could be obtained by blending #eafec2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#757f61 color description : Dark grayish green.
#757f61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#757f61 has RGB values of R:117, G:127,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 7700321.
